Microcontrollori ARM STM32F105VCT6 - MCU 32BIT Cortex 64/25 LINEA DI CONNETTIVITÀ M3
♠ Descrizzione di u pruduttu
Attributu di u pruduttu | Valore di l'attributu |
Fabbricante: | STMicroelectronics |
Categoria di u pruduttu: | Microcontrollori ARM - MCU |
Serie: | STM32F105VC |
Stile di muntatura: | SMD/SMT |
Pacchettu / Custodia: | LQFP-100 |
Core: | ARM Cortex M3 |
Dimensione di a memoria di u prugramma: | 256 kB |
Larghezza di u bus di dati: | 32 bit |
Risoluzione ADC: | 12 bit |
Frequenza massima di clock: | 72 MHz |
Numeru d'I/O: | 80 E/S |
Dimensione di a RAM di dati: | 64 kB |
Tensione di alimentazione - Min: | 2 V |
Tensione di alimentazione - Max: | 3,6 V |
Temperatura minima di funziunamentu: | - 40°C |
Temperatura massima di funziunamentu: | + 85°C |
Imballaggio: | Vassoio |
Marca: | STMicroelectronics |
Tipu di RAM di dati: | SRAM |
Altezza: | 1,4 mm |
Tipu d'interfaccia: | CAN, I2C, SPI, USART |
Lunghezza: | 14 mm |
Sensibile à l'umidità: | Iè |
Numeru di canali ADC: | 16 Canali |
Numeru di Timer/Contatori: | 10 Cronometru |
Serie di processori: | ARM Cortex M |
Tipu di pruduttu: | Microcontrollori ARM - MCU |
Tipu di memoria di prugramma: | Lampu |
Quantità di pacchettu di fabbrica: | 540 |
Sottucateguria: | Microcontrollori - MCU |
Nome cummerciale: | STM32 |
Larghezza: | 14 mm |
Pesu unitariu: | 0,046530 once |
• Core: CPU ARM® Cortex®-M3 à 32 bit - frequenza massima di 72 MHz, prestazioni di 1,25 DMIPS/MHz (Dhrystone 2.1) à accessu à a memoria in statu d'attesa 0
– Moltiplicazione à ciclu unicu è divisione di hardware
• Ricordi
– Da 64 à 256 Kbyte di memoria Flash
– 64 Kbyte di SRAM di usu generale
• Orologiu, reset è gestione di l'approvvigionamentu
– Alimentazione di l'applicazione da 2,0 à 3,6 V è I/O
– POR, PDR, è rilevatore di tensione programmabile (PVD)
– Oscillatore à cristallu da 3 à 25 MHz
– RC internu di 8 MHz cunfiguratu in fabbrica
– RC interna 40 kHz cù calibrazione
– Oscillatore 32 kHz per RTC cù calibrazione
• Bassa putenza
– Modi di sonnu, stop è standby
– Alimentazione VBAT per RTC è registri di salvezza
• 2 convertitori A/D à 12 bit è 1 µs (16 canali)
– Gamma di cunversione: da 0 à 3,6 V
– Capacità di campionamentu è di mantenimentu
– Sensore di temperatura
– finu à 2 MSPS in modu interleaved
• 2 × convertitori D/A à 12 bit
• DMA: cuntrollore DMA à 12 canali
– Periferiche supportate: timer, ADC, DAC, I2S, SPI, I2C è USART
• Modu di debugging
– Debug di fili seriali (SWD) è interfacce JTAG
– Cortex®-M3 Macrocell™ di traccia integrata
• Finu à 80 porte I/O veloci
– 51/80 I/O, tutti mappabili nantu à 16 vettori d'interruzzione esterni è quasi tutti tolleranti à 5 V
• Unità di calculu CRC, ID unicu di 96 bit
• Finu à 10 timer cù capacità di rimappatura di pinout
– Finu à quattru temporizzatori à 16 bit, ognunu cù finu à 4 input IC/OC/PWM o contatore d'impulsi è encoder in quadratura (incrementale)
– 1 × timer PWM di cuntrollu di u mutore à 16 bit cù generazione di tempu mortu è arrestu d'emergenza
– 2 × timer di guardia (indipendenti è di finestra)
– Timer SysTick: un contatore decrescente di 24 bit
– 2 × timer basichi à 16 bit per pilotà u DAC
• Finu à 14 interfacce di cumunicazione cù capacità di rimappatura di pinout
– Finu à 2 × interfacce I2C (SMBus/PMBus)
– Finu à 5 USART (interfaccia ISO 7816, LIN, capacità IrDA, cuntrollu di modem)
– Finu à 3 SPI (18 Mbit/s), 2 cù una interfaccia I2S multiplexata chì offre precisione di classe audio via schemi PLL avanzati
– 2 × interfacce CAN (2.0B Attiva) cù 512 byte di SRAM dedicata
– Dispositivu/host/controller OTG USB 2.0 à piena velocità cù PHY integratu chì supporta HNP/SRP/ID cù 1,25 Kbyte di SRAM dedicata
– MAC Ethernet 10/100 cù DMA è SRAM dedicati (4 Kbyte): supportu hardware IEEE1588, MII/RMII dispunibule nantu à tutti i pacchetti